Inching forward
Nov. 21st, 2015 05:25 pmProgress on backspin and loop! You know, for my definition of progress on these particular elements, which is kind of like two steps forward, one and three quarter steps back. P had me do the inside-three-turn-in-place-with-free-leg-forward exercise and then go into the spin from that. It works a bit better than what I've been doing; it gets me turning on the right part of the blade, but now I go up too far on the toe pick instead of staying too far back. When I bail on it now, my left foot crosses my right to touch the ice, which is a good sign. (It's also how J the Younger broke her ankle, but I'm steadfastly refusing to think about that.)
Loop improvement is so minimal and hard to describe in words that I won't even try, but at least it's less crappy. Ugh, that jump.
I got my outside counters back, woo! And outside brackets to boot. They aren't pretty, but they turn almost as often as they don't. And P gave me a Curry exercise to do with outside rockers that disguises the fact that I can't hold the outside edge after the turn very well, hee.
